Germany’s administrative divisions are actually rather peculiar.
The Rhine River is the dividing line between the states of Hesse and Rhineland-Palatinate.
It cuts diagonally through the center of Mainz from northwest to southeast, splitting the city in two.
The Caesar Bridge connects the two sides.
Here’s the peculiar part: the east bank of the Rhine River belongs to the state of Hesse, with its capital at Wiesbaden. Meanwhile, the west bank belongs to Rhineland-Palatinate, with its capital at Mainz.
This creates a strange situation. Three districts on the east bank of the Rhine are just a river’s breadth away from Mainz proper. They even have "Mainz" in their names and are geographically closer to it, yet they are administered by Wiesbaden, the capital of Hesse.
According to Schürrle, the locals in Mainz have always felt the city can’t expand because those three districts were "swallowed" by Wiesbaden.
That’s why whenever Mainz plays against Wiesbaden, they always give it their all.
